Understanding the Academic Calendar

The University of Wyoming's academic calendar is a crucial tool for students to plan their academic year. The calendar outlines important dates, deadlines, and events that students need to be aware of to stay on track with their studies. From semester start and end dates to holidays and exam schedules, the academic calendar provides a comprehensive overview of the academic year.

The University of Wyoming's academic calendar is typically released at the beginning of each academic year and is available on the university's website. Students can access the calendar online and plan their schedule accordingly. The calendar is also subject to change, so students are advised to check the university's website regularly for updates.

Key Dates and Deadlines

The academic calendar is divided into two main semesters: fall and spring. Each semester has its own set of important dates and deadlines, including the start and end of classes, mid-term exams, and final exams. Additionally, the calendar includes holidays and breaks, such as Thanksgiving and winter break, which can affect class schedules and other university activities.

Some key dates and deadlines to keep in mind include the start of classes, which typically takes place in late August for the fall semester and late January for the spring semester. Other important dates include the last day to add or drop classes, the deadline to apply for graduation, and the date of final exams. Students should also be aware of the university's holiday schedule, which can affect class schedules and other university activities.
